Don't They Know it's Friday? has been the definitive guide to business culture and etiquette in the Gulf since it was first published in 1998. This exciting and informative book has been reprinted thirteen times. Motivate Publishing is now releasing a new edition fully updated with new information, maps and illustrations. This modern and enlarged second edition is packed with remarkable insights into Gulf life and business; the book is required reading for anyone having business and other interests in the GCC and in the wider Middle East. The book prepares its readers for many life-style changes. It addresses in particular the cross-cultural aspects of life affecting westerners and other nationalities in business with nationals in or from Kuwait, Saudi Arabia, Bahrain, Qatar, the UAE and Oman. It deals with the realities of Gulf business and outlines the stresses and strains which most visitors or expatriates will experience. Don't They Know it's Friday gives excellent guidance on proper behavior in the Arab world generally and in the Gulf particularly.
